Output e543374354ba3315a8056b853a2b04aae530fd0d6b30838bf056fd657094ad67:46

value
5106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 876d74f01bb3e7b2e38444d75c5394d3a5b5e48a8b215d93a7fa0db85fb9be55
address
bc1psakhfuqmk0nm9cuygnt4c5u56wjmtey23vs4mya8lgxmshaehe2s7wvru0
transaction
e543374354ba3315a8056b853a2b04aae530fd0d6b30838bf056fd657094ad67
spent
true